With under two weeks left to go before the deadline for application, women entrepreneurs across Ireland are being urged to ‘back themselves’ and apply to Visa’s She’s Next programme for a chance to win one of five grants together with mentorship and resources to help their business thrive.

Applications for Visa’s She’s Next Grant Programme will close on April 9th, providing five small Irish businesses with a total of €90,000 in business funding together with expert coaching from some of Ireland’s most respected businesswomen, Aimee Connolly (founder and CEO, Sculpted by Aimee), Breege O’Donoghue (former board member, Primark) and Gráinne Mullins (founder, Grá Chocolates).

Ines Obtinalla, Head of Marketing, Ireland at Visa, said: “While progress has been made, women entrepreneurs in Ireland are still facing barriers to funding and mentorship. Visa backs small businesses with big ambitions, and this programme will deliver the resources and expertise to power our five winners’ next steps.”

2026 Visa She’s Next – What Winners Receive

—  Four women entrepreneurs will each receive €10,000; one overall winner will receive €50,000
—  All winners will receive mentoring from three of Ireland’s leading businesswomen: Aimee Connolly, Breege O’Donoghue and Gráinne Mullins
—  Individual and group pitch preparation sessions
—  Access to ongoing supports available through Visa’s She’s Next alumni network

How to apply

Visa’s She’s Next Grant Programme is open to small businesses and organisations in the Republic of Ireland that are majority owned by women, operating across all industries and sectors. To enter, applicants are asked to complete a short submission on visa.ie/shesnext by 9th April 2026.

To date, Visa’s She’s Next Grant Programme has awarded €215,000 in funding and coaching to 20 women entrepreneurs in Ireland to help them take their next business step. Last year’s winners were:

—  €50,000 grant recipient & overall winner; Claire Fullam – Remi Scalp Care
—  Marian Kennedy – Anewmum
—  Sinéad Ryan – Little Fitness
—  Denise Walsh – Curly Co
—  Lisa Kleiner – Nibbed Cacao
